Background and Problem Solved

The original patent disclosed aerosol generating articles and methods for manufacturing the same, but these approaches were limited by their inability to optimize aerosol production based on user preferences and environmental conditions, and lacked real-time monitoring and quality control capabilities. The present invention solves these problems by introducing synergistic combinations of technologies to create a more efficient, personalized, and secure aerosol generation system.

Alternative Embodiments and Variations

Alternative embodiments of the invention may include different types of sensors, such as optical or acoustic sensors, or different types of thermal interfaces, such as graphene-based or ceramic-based interfaces. The invention may also be adapted for use in various industries, such as p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, or food technology, or integrated with different devices, such as wearable devices or smartphones.
